of Role
The Corporate Counsel is a practical, solutions-oriented attorney who takes ownership of case strategy, managing outside counsel, and driving favorable outcomes for the business. As a trusted advisor, the Corporate Counsel will also have a lead role in important corporate initiatives such as managing the company’s dispute portfolio, overseeing discovery and e-discovery processes, conducting internal investigations, and serving as a key cross-functional contact on litigation risk.


Strategic & Tactical

  • Manage and oversee the company’s litigation matters, including pre-litigation disputes, active lawsuits, arbitrations, and similar escalated disputes from inception through resolution
  • Proactively manage regulatory investigations and inquiries (such as attorney general investigations and contractor’s board complaints) by finding resolutions to such investigations and forging relationships with applicable regulatory offices.
  • Manage insurance claims from filing and discovery through resolution. Partner with insurance and risk teams to create transparent and streamlined claims processes.
  • Select, retain and manage outside counsel, including negotiating engagement terms, setting case budgets and monitoring performance against litigation objectives
  • Develop and execute litigation strategy, including drafting and reviewing pleadings, motions, discovery responses, settlement agreements and other litigation-related documents
  • Oversee e-discovery processes, including preservation, collection, review and production of electronically stored information in coordination with internal IT and business teams
  • Provide day-to-day counsel to internal stakeholders on litigation risk, dispute avoidance strategies, and escalation of potential claims, including advising on litigation holds and document retention obligations
  • Evaluate and drive resolution of disputes through negotiation, mediation, arbitration and litigation to achieve outcomes aligned with the company’s business objectives and risk tolerance
  • Monitor and report on the company’s litigation portfolio, including maintaining matter management systems, tracking costs, trends, and risk factors to the business and providing an actionable feedback loop to business leaders to improve escalation metrics
  • Develop and present training to various personnel throughout the organization on litigation risk mitigation, document retention, and best practices for reducing the company’s exposure to disputes
  • Other duties and assignments determined by the Assistant General Counsel to support internal stakeholders and continually enhance processes for execution of the company's strategies

Qualifications:

  • 5 or more years of litigation experience, including substantial experience in a law firm and/or in-house litigation role; experience managing complex commercial or regulatory litigation is highly preferred; public company experience a plus
  • Strong analytical and legal research skills with the ability to assess case law, evaluate risk exposure and develop creative litigation strategies
  • Motivated self-starter with a strong ownership mentality who creatively identifies and resolves issues
  • Familiarity with e-discovery tools and processes, litigation management software, and legal hold procedures
  • Ability to prioritize and work with a sense of urgency in a high-growth environment where priorities shift and judgment matters while delivering at a high level with a collaborative, customer service approach.
  • Exceptional degree of integrity, ethics and trust; highly professional with the ability to maintain confidence
  • J.D. from an accredited law school; admitted to at least one state bar in the U.S.
  • Exemplary written and verbal communication skills
